package org.apache.carbondata.core.scan.collector;
import org.apache.carbondata.common.logging.LogServiceFactory;
import org.apache.carbondata.core.scan.collector.impl.AbstractScannedResultCollector;
import org.apache.carbondata.core.scan.collector.impl.DictionaryBasedResultCollector;
import org.apache.carbondata.core.scan.collector.impl.DictionaryBasedVectorResultCollector;
import org.apache.carbondata.core.scan.collector.impl.RawBasedResultCollector;
import org.apache.carbondata.core.scan.collector.impl.RestructureBasedDictionaryResultCollector;
import org.apache.carbondata.core.scan.collector.impl.RestructureBasedRawResultCollector;
import org.apache.carbondata.core.scan.collector.impl.RestructureBasedVectorResultCollector;
import org.apache.carbondata.core.scan.collector.impl.RowIdBasedResultCollector;
import org.apache.carbondata.core.scan.collector.impl.RowIdRawBasedResultCollector;
import org.apache.carbondata.core.scan.collector.impl.RowIdRestructureBasedRawResultCollector;
import org.apache.carbondata.core.scan.executor.infos.BlockExecutionInfo;
import org.apache.log4j.Logger;
/**
* This class will provide the result collector instance based on the required type
*/
public class ResultCollectorFactory {
/**
* logger of result collector factory
*/
private static final Logger LOGGER =
LogServiceFactory.getLogService(ResultCollectorFactory.class.getName());
/**
* This method will create result collector based on the given type
*
* @param blockExecutionInfo
* @return
*/
public static AbstractScannedResultCollector getScannedResultCollector(
BlockExecutionInfo blockExecutionInfo) {
AbstractScannedResultCollector scannerResultAggregator = null;
if (blockExecutionInfo.isRawRecordDetailQuery()) {
if (blockExecutionInfo.isRestructuredBlock()) {
if (blockExecutionInfo.isRequiredRowId()) {
LOGGER.info("RowId Restructure based raw collector is used to scan and collect the data");
scannerResultAggregator = new RowIdRestructureBasedRawResultCollector(blockExecutionInfo);
} else {
LOGGER.info("Restructure based raw collector is used to scan and collect the data");
scannerResultAggregator = new RestructureBasedRawResultCollector(blockExecutionInfo);
}
} else {
if (blockExecutionInfo.isRequiredRowId()) {
LOGGER.info("RowId based raw collector is used to scan and collect the data");
scannerResultAggregator = new RowIdRawBasedResultCollector(blockExecutionInfo);
} else {
LOGGER.info("Row based raw collector is used to scan and collect the data");
scannerResultAggregator = new RawBasedResultCollector(blockExecutionInfo);
}
}
} else if (blockExecutionInfo.isVectorBatchCollector()) {
if (blockExecutionInfo.isRestructuredBlock()) {
LOGGER.info("Restructure dictionary vector collector is used to scan and collect the data");
scannerResultAggregator = new RestructureBasedVectorResultCollector(blockExecutionInfo);
} else {
LOGGER.info("Vector based dictionary collector is used to scan and collect the data");
scannerResultAggregator = new DictionaryBasedVectorResultCollector(blockExecutionInfo);
}
} else {
if (blockExecutionInfo.isRestructuredBlock()) {
LOGGER.info("Restructure based dictionary collector is used to scan and collect the data");
scannerResultAggregator = new RestructureBasedDictionaryResultCollector(blockExecutionInfo);
} else if (blockExecutionInfo.isRequiredRowId()) {
LOGGER.info("RowId based dictionary collector is used to scan and collect the data");
scannerResultAggregator = new RowIdBasedResultCollector(blockExecutionInfo);
} else {
LOGGER.info("Row based dictionary collector is used to scan and collect the data");
scannerResultAggregator = new DictionaryBasedResultCollector(blockExecutionInfo);
}
}
return scannerResultAggregator;
}
private ResultCollectorFactory() {
}
}
